A recent analysis found that deaths from ectopic pregnancies have nearly doubled. This type of pregnancy occurs when a fertilized egg implants outside the uterus, often in a fallopian tube. The embryo's growth can cause the organ to rupture, typically in the first trimester.
The increase in deaths is more pronounced in states with abortion bans, such as Texas. Further details on this trend can be found in the original report.
The data on ectopic pregnancy deaths comes from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, and the analysis was conducted by ProPublica.
